An opinionated Go SDK for implementing KRM functions.
A KRM function is a program that reads Kubernetes resources from STDIN, transforms or validates them, and writes the result to STDOUT. The SDK handles the I/O — you write the logic.
package main
import (
"context"
_ "embed"
"os"
"github.com/kptdev/krm-functions-sdk/go/fn"
)
//go:embed README.md
var readme []byte
//go:embed metadata.yaml
var metadata []byte
type SetLabels struct {
Labels map[string]string `json:"labels,omitempty"`
}
func (r *SetLabels) Run(ctx *fn.Context, functionConfig *fn.KubeObject, items fn.KubeObjects, results *fn.Results) bool {
for _, obj := range items {
for k, v := range r.Labels {
obj.SetLabel(k, v)
}
}
return true
}
func main() {
runner := fn.WithContext(context.Background(), &SetLabels{})
if err := fn.AsMain(runner, fn.WithDocs(readme, metadata)); err != nil {
os.Exit(1)
}
}A starter template is available at go/get-started/. For the full walkthrough, see the Tutorial.
fn.AsMain is the single entrypoint. It handles:
- STDIN/STDOUT (default) — reads a ResourceList, processes it, writes the result
- File mode — pass file paths as positional args for local debugging
--help— prints human-readable docs from embedded README markers--doc— outputs machine-readable JSON (consumed bykpt fn docand catalog pipelines)
Register embedded documentation with fn.WithDocs:
fn.AsMain(runner, fn.WithDocs(readme, metadata))The SDK provides two interfaces for implementing functions:
| Interface | Use for | Can add/remove items? | Auto-parses config? |
|---|---|---|---|
fn.Runner |
Transformers, validators | No | Yes |
fn.ResourceListProcessor |
Generators, complex functions | Yes | No |
